If you purchase Quietum Plus from the main website, you will … fd 55mm f/1.2 s.s.c. asphericalWebMay 28, 2024 · A cost-plus outlines how both direct and indirect costs will be covered and how they will be reimbursed to the contractor. But these costs only make up a portion of the agreement. This type of contract also includes an additional, predetermined amount to be paid to the contractor on top of expenses.
